Veterans Day Ceremony

Libraries are civic organizations.  When we developed Library Park, a flagpole opposite the Library entrance became an essential part of the design.  Since November 2017, a Veterans Day ceremony has become a tradition at the Library & Music Hall. Sourdough Culture: An Author Visit with Eric Pallant

Andrew Carnegie Free Library & Music Hall 300 Beechwood Avenue, Carnegie, PA, United States

From the Egyptian Pyramids to ancient Rome, sourdough has propped up some of humanity's great achievements. Explore the history, enjoy sampling Eric's own breads, and bring your questions about caring for sourdough starters and baking the perfect loaf.
